What this is — and is not
Every figure comes from DLD-registered transactions, grouped by layout. Dubai's open data has no unit numbers, so “identical layouts” means the same building and bedroom count — it cannot distinguish a high floor with a marina view from the same layout facing the road. Registered prices also trail today's asks by the time a deal takes to close. Use this as negotiation evidence, not a valuation.
